Wynn, Ed (1886-1966) Actor; a Disney favorite who appeared in The Absent-Minded Professor (fire chief), Babes in Toyland (toymaker), Son of Flubber (A. J. Allen), Mary Poppins (Uncle Albert), Those Calloways (Ed Parker), That Darn Cat! (Mr. Hofstedder), The Gnome-Mobile (Rufus), and provided the voice of the Mad Hatter in Alice in Wonderland. Wurlitzer Music Hall Shop on Main Street at Disneyland from July 1955 to September 1968. A fondly remembered shop where you could hear pianos, player pianos, and organs demonstrated, or buy rolls for your own player piano.

Wyatt, Jane (1910-2006) Actress; appeared in Treasure of Matecumbe (Aunt Effie).

Wrubel, Allie (1905-1973) Songwriter; won an Academy Award for “Zip-A-Dee-Doo-Dah,” and wrote songs also for Make Mine Music and Melody Time.

Wuzzles, The Odd group of characters, each two animals in one, living on the Isle of Wuz, created for a 1985 television series. Names included Bumblelion, Eleroo, Hoppopotamus, Moosel, Rhinokey, and Butterbear. Voices include Brian Cummings (Bumblelion), Jo Anne Worley (Hoppopotamus), Henry Gibson (Eleroo), Bill Scott (Moosel), Alan Oppenheimer (Rhinokey). SEE ALSO DISNEY’S WUZZLES.

Writing Magic: With Figment and Alice in Wonderland (film) Educational film, in the EPCOT Educational Media Collection; released in August 1989. 16 min. Brainstorming, writing, and rewriting are the keys to solving Alice’s dilemma.

Writing Process, The: A Conversation with Mavis Jukes (film) Educational film; released on July 3, 1989. 20 min. The award-winning author shares her perspectives on creative writing.
